Trying to get enough kids to form a decent football team isn?t easy! It?s not just the playing time involved on the weekends; it?s the training sessions after school and at night too. But when the Wildcats reluctantly take on Peta `Gazza? Gascoigne to make up the numbers, they quickly discover that she?s the best player they?ve got. Not only that, she?s got an attractive and apparently unattached?or loosely attached?mum. And Splinters is looking for a new partner for his dad. Everything looks set on and off the field, but Gazza and her mum have been deported back to England for overstaying their visa and suddenly disappeared without a trace. Nothing for it but to fly to England, track them down and persuade them to come back. But where are the Wildcats going to get the money? Nuke gets the bright idea that they can borrow his father?s credit card and book their flights on the internet. And that?s where the real trouble begins!
